Provide clothes for woman to successMany single low-income women who try to enter the work force find themselves competing for jobs that require business clothes they can’t afford.That’s where Suited for Change comes in.“We offer women professional attire and professional consultation to assist them in entering or re-entering the workforce,” says Michelle Yorkman, a Program Director at Suited for Change.The D.C. non-profit is all about empowering women, whatever their background, unemployed or on welfare, recovering drug addicts, victims of domestic abuse, recent immigrants.Over the past 15 years, the organization has helped more than 12,000 women as they looked for work.“We have a seminar series that happens two or three times a year where we do image consultation,she says.“We show you how to dress and behave professionally. We offer business etiquette training, financial management skills.The kind of human resources, paperwork management, how to learn about your benefits, everything that they can possibly need to get in the door and once they are there to be successful.”After completing a job training or skills-development program, Suited for Change women are ready to be dressed for success, to donations from individuals, companies and manufacturers.“We have suits. We have ates. We have dresses,” she says. “During winter months, we have coats.
